Suspension of Members Article 13: 1. Members of the Commission shall be suspended in the following circumstances: 1. Death, resignation or retirement; 2. Convicted of treason or crimes against humanity by a competent court; 3. Suffering from a refractory bodily or mental disease that hinders the performance of duties; 4. Assignment of the members to other duties by the President for a period of more than 6 months; 5. Removal by the Commission 2. The Commission can, under the conditions described in the first paragraph of this article, propose to the President a new competent person within one month to fill the vacant post. Conditions for Removal of the Members Article 14: 1. Members of the Commission shall, based on sufficient documents available and clear reasons, be removed from the membership of the Commission for any of the following reasons: a. Lack of competency in performing assigned duties; b. Violating the confidentiality of the commission; c. Violating the provisions of this law; 2. Removal of a member of the Commission, as set out in the paragraph 1 of the present Article, shall happen based on the existence of clear, documented reasons and upon the proposal of two thirds of the members of the Commission and the approval of the President. Resignation Article 15: Members of the commission shall submit their letter of resignation to the Commission. The resignation shall be subject to approval by the President. 7
